Problem

Display devices suffer from afterimage defects due to the connection issues between light emitting elements and circuits, which affect the reliability and longevity of the display panel.

Innovation Solution

The display device incorporates a base layer with voltage lines, a transistor, a light emitting element, and a connection wiring line with a protruding tip portion that electrically disconnects the cathode, along with insulating layers and capping patterns to enhance electrical connectivity and reduce afterimage defects.

Data Source

PatentUS12505799B2Display device having reduced afterimage defects
Publication Date: 2025.12.23 SAMSUNG DISPLAY CO LTD

AI summary

A display device including a base layer, a plurality of voltage lines and a transistor that are disposed on the base layer, a light emitting element electrically connected to the transistor and including a cathode, and a connection wiring line electrically connected to the light emitting element and including a first connection part spaced apart from a light emitting opening defined in the light emitting element, and a second connection part electrically connected to the transistor. The first connection part overlaps some of the plurality of voltage lines in plan view.
